What Is a Brand Story?

A brand story is a narrative that showcases your company’s mission and forms a deeper, emotional connection with your audience. 

It can sometimes include plenty of marketing lingo, but in reality, brand storytelling is way more than (content) marketing. It humanizes your brand, making it relatable and memorable.

What Should You Include in Your Brand Story?

When crafting your brand story, there are a few key elements that you should consider including. 

First and foremost, you should include a clear and compelling description of why your brand exists and your core values. This should be the foundation of your story, and it should help communicate to your customers what sets your brand apart from the competition.

Another important element to include in your brand story is a clear sense of your brand’s personality and voice. This can help create a sense of connection and familiarity with your customers, and also help differentiate your brand from others in your industry.

You should also consider including some personal anecdotes or stories that help illustrate the values and personality of your brand. These brand stories help to create an emotional connection with your customers and make your brand more memorable.

Finally, you should include some information about your brand’s history and evolution over time. This can help to demonstrate the longevity and stability of your brand, and it can also help to build trust with your customers. 

Overall, a strong brand story should be: 

  • Authentic
  • Engaging
  • Memorable

…and it should help to create a sense of connection and loyalty with your customers!

How Do You Write a Successful Brand Story?

Since we humans seek the need for connection and community, it’s easy to understand why a great brand story is an effective way to approach new customers. It also strengthens the connection with existing ones. To begin crafting your compelling brand story, it’s essential for you to have a complete understanding of your brand’s:

  1. Vision
  2. Values
  3. Mission
Man writing besides his laptop.

But also you have to question yourself. What sets you apart from competitors? What drives your passion? Why does your brand exist, and what unique pain point does it come to solve?

Again, answering these questions lays the foundation for writing a strong brand story. A brand story template with the basic steps needed to start is a great idea, and you should use it for your brand’s core values. 

The important bits you should include in your template are: 

  • What problem does your company want to solve, and what’s your purpose
  • What solutions does your company offer to said problem
  • What is your vision, and will it help your end result

Remember: A well-crafted brand story is the beginning. Being able to make that story connect with people is the challenging part.

With that said, let’s go ahead and talk about the elements of a good brand story.

1. Defining the Audience You’re Speaking To

Understanding your target audience is crucial in tailoring your brand story to resonate with their needs and desires. Conduct thorough market research to identify your target market. What are their pain points? What motivates them?

By empathizing with your audience, you can tailor your narrative to address their concerns and aspirations. Speak their language, evoke their emotions, and offer solutions that align with their values.

2. Finding What Your Brand Is About

Your brand story should reflect who you are, what you stand for, and why you exist. Ideally, you need to self-reflect, identify your brand’s origin, and find a way to communicate that to your audience. 

What inspired its inception? Share anecdotes, experiences, or pivotal moments that shaped your journey. Authenticity is key; your audience craves genuine narratives that resonate with their emotions. Highlight your brand values, beliefs, and the problem you aim to solve. Your brand’s purpose should shine through every aspect of your storytelling.

3. Focus on Compelling Content (Messaging)

With a clear understanding of your brand’s essence and target audience, it’s time to craft compelling content that brings your brand story to life and speaks the language of your audience.

Leverage various content marketing channels, including blogs, social media, videos, and podcasts, to convey your narrative and share the human side of your company.

Use evocative language, captivating visuals, and storytelling techniques to engage your audience on an emotional level.

4. Build Brand Consistency and Keep it Simple

Consistency is paramount in building brand recognition and fostering trust with your audience. But so is being easy to understand and connect to. Ensure your brand story is reflected in every touchpoint, from your website design to your customer interactions and your blog posts

Maintain a cohesive brand identity across all channels, incorporating your narrative into your brand messaging, visuals, and tone of voice. Consistent storytelling reinforces your brand’s identity and cultivates a sense of familiarity and loyalty among your audience.

Your messaging should be simple and concise to be able to talk to your audience more effectively.
